The Master 2 Analysis, Modeling, Simulation (AMS) offers a full range of training in these fields, ranging from the most theoretical approaches to concrete developments (numerical modeling and simulations). The implementation and development of numerical approximation methods firstly require a good knowledge of mathematical equations (differential equations, partial differential equations) but also of the phenomena they account for. Finally, the efficient implementation of the associated approximation algorithms cannot be conceived without a solid knowledge of computer science. This program allows students to: Master and implement high-level mathematical tools and methods; Understand and mathematically model a problem in order to solve it; Analyze a research document with a view to its synthesis and exploitation; Master digital tools and reference programming languages; Clearly explain a theory and mathematical results; Analyze data and implement numerical simulations.

Admission Requirements

90+
6.5+
  • Completion of a Master 1 in Mathematics at the Institut Polytechnique de Paris, or a 2nd / 3rd year of Engineering School, or an equivalent in France or abroad.
